Output f8614f00e64d53d734b32fba61c3255ca7d6f0d8b6488d6bba7aad9c50e26d0e:1

value
58495411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c576143158b1e4fe61db6789d8d62358f1a25663 OP_EQUAL
address
3Kh6Vbg1Dy8qoo22XdPDh95L3kVmWrqt5T
transaction
f8614f00e64d53d734b32fba61c3255ca7d6f0d8b6488d6bba7aad9c50e26d0e
confirmations
343262
spent
true